**What you'll be doing**

The Pregnancy Connect Medical Lead provides leadership and clinical expertise within the Murrumbidgee Tiered Perinatal Network (TPN) working collaboratively with the Pregnancy Connect Coordinator, Maternity Co-leaders, and individual sites within their district and TPN to support implementation of all aspects of Pregnancy Connect.

The Pregnancy Connect Medical Lead should have a detailed knowledge of service capabilities of all facilities within the MLHD and ACT Tiered Maternity and Neonatal Network (TMNN) and will be responsible for
- ensuring that timely and expert clinical advice is always available within the TPN, particularly in time critical situations (including for maternal transfers)
- establishing and ensuring clinical outreach models of care are available, including virtual care
- supporting and building capabilities of regional and rural maternity care providers
- participating in quality and safety activities, including case review, data analysis and reporting.
- be the key contact for the perinatal transfer advice for the TMNN.

The Clinical Lead will work closely with the other Clinical leads across NSW/ACT and MoH partners
